Eskimo-Aleut
Eskimo-Aleut is a language family native to Greenland, the Canadian Arctic and Alaska. It consists of Inuktitut (the language of the Inuit) and the Aleut language. The Eskimo-Aleut language family is tree is below:Eskimo-Aleut
